James A. Smith

Degrees
- M.A., Applied Linguistics, Northern Territories University, Australia, 2002
- B.Sc. (Hons.) Electronic and Electrical Engineering, University of Surrey, UK, 1978
Current positions
- International Literacy and Education Consultant (2010– )
- SIL Asia Area Multilingual Education and Literacy Consultant (2003–present)
- Multilingual Education (MLE) and Literacy Consultant (1998–present)
Other experience
- Tutor/Instructor: Multilingual Education for Minority Language Contexts course, ETP, Horsleys Green, Buckinghamshire, England (April 2010)
- Consultant and Trainer: MLE Kindergarten Materials Production Workshop – 5 languages; Kuching, Sarawak, Malaysia (December, 2008)
- Consultant/Organizer/Facilitator: First Malaysian Indigenous Peoples Conference on Education (MIPCE) (April 23–30, 2007)
- Consultant and Trainer: MLE Materials Production. 5 language groups, 4 sponsoring NGOs; Dhaka, Bangladesh (August 13–17, 2006)
- Coordinator and Organizer: Sabah Lexicography Workshop for 16 Language Groups; Rampayan Laut, Kota Belud, Sabah, Malaysia (June 6–17, 2005)
- Consultant and Trainer: Beginning Indigenous Writers’ Workshops series. Kota Belud, Sabah, Malaysia; March, April, May, 4 weeks total (2004)
- Instructor: Asia SIL, Literacy Courses, Darwin, Australia (2002)
- Consultant and Presenter: Seminar/Workshops on Translation Principles, Literacy Issues, Cultural Anthropology and Language Learning. Caribbean Island Nations of Barbados, Cayman Islands, Curacao, Jamaica, St. Lucia, Trinidad and Tobago (January–October 2001)
